Safety Statistics•More than 5,500
workers die from injuries each year
•Annually, 1.3 million workers miss workdays from injuries
•Employees with fewer than 6 years on the job sustain 37% of illnesses and injuries

Fire Response•Know location of fire
extinguishers•Use the right
extinguisher for the job•Know how to use
extinguisher:• Pull the pin• Aim hose at fire base• Squeeze trigger• Sweep hose back
and forth

Back Safety•Assess load and route•Lift safely:
• Bend at knees• Pull load close to body• Face your load—
don’t twist your body• Let legs do lifting by
standing with back straight•Don’t overextend
when reaching•Use a footrest if
standing for long periods

DON’TDOUse plugs that fit the outletCheck wire and cord insulationMake sure electrical connections are tightKeep flammables away from outletsKeep clear access to electrical boxes
Electrical Hazards
Overload outletsFasten cords with staples, nailsRun cords through water or touch cords with wet handsUse damaged cordsUse ungrounded cords or remove grounding prong from a three-pronged plug
